Abstract

The utility model provides a vertical injection molding machine which comprises a frame platform, a lower fixing substrate, support frames, an upper mould clamping cylinder body, pull rods, piston rods, mobile upper mould plates and auxiliary oil cylinders, wherein the lower fixing substrate is placed on the frame platform; the two support frames are placed on the lower fixing substrate in an opposite manner; the upper mould clamping cylinder body is erected on the support frames; the pull rods penetrate through the upper mould clamping cylinder body, the support frames, the lower fixing substrate and the frame platform sequentially; the two ends of each pull rod are fixed through nuts; the upper mould clamping cylinder body comprises at least two oil cylinders; each oil cylinder comprises a guide sleeve; one piston rod is inserted in the guide sleeve; the lower ends of each two piston rods are connected with one mobile upper mould plate; one auxiliary oil cylinder is arranged on the outer side of each oil cylinder, and connected with the outer side surface of the mobile upper mould plate through a plug pin; sliding sleeves are arranged at the corners of the outer side surface of the mobile upper mould plates; slide rails are arranged on the inner side surface of the support frames; the sliding sleeves are connected with the slide rails in a sliding manner. The vertical injection molding machine provided by the utility model has the advantages as follows: the operation table facet is lowered, the production efficiency is improved, and shaking of the mobile upper mould plate can be avoided while the rigidity of the equipment is enhanced.

A kind of vertical injection molding machine
Technical field
The utility model relates to a kind of vertical injection molding machine, belongs to mechanical device field.
Background technology
Existing vertical injection molding machine, driving arrangement and movable device are all in operating table surface below, make operating table surface height higher, use very inconvenience, and locked mode portable plate in use can produce and rock, and affect production precision.
Utility model content
The technical problems to be solved in the utility model is to overcome existing defect, and a kind of vertical injection molding machine is provided, and changes original structure, not only reduces operating table surface, avoids locked mode portable plate to produce simultaneously and rocks.
In order to solve the problems of the technologies described above, the utility model provides following technical scheme:
, comprise pallet, lower fixing base, bracing frame, upper locked mode cylinder body, pull bar, piston rod, movable cope match-plate pattern and auxiliary cylinder; Lower fixing base is placed in pallet upper surface, lower fixing base upper surface two bracing frames staggered relatively, and locked mode cylinder body is set up in bracing frame upper surface, and pull bar is successively through upper locked mode cylinder body, bracing frame, lower fixing base and pallet, and two ends are fixed with nut; Upper locked mode cylinder body comprises at least two oil cylinders, and a guide pin bushing is contained in each oil cylinder lower surface, inserts a piston rod in each guide pin bushing, and the lower end of every two piston rods connects the upper surface of a movable cope match-plate pattern; The lateral surface of each oil cylinder of upper locked mode cylinder body is provided with an auxiliary cylinder, and auxiliary cylinder is connected with the lateral surface of movable cope match-plate pattern by latch; Movable cope match-plate pattern lateral surface corner is provided with sliding sleeve, and bracing frame medial surface is provided with slide rail, and sliding sleeve and slide rail are slidably connected.
Further, pull bar quantity is four.
Further, oil cylinder quantity is four, and piston rod quantity is four, and movable cope match-plate pattern quantity is two.
Further, the quantity of sliding sleeve and slide rail is four.
A kind of vertical injection molding machine of the utility model, has reduced operating table surface, has improved production efficiency, has avoided movable cope match-plate pattern to produce and rock when having strengthened equipment rigidity.

The specific embodiment
Below in conjunction with accompanying drawing, preferred embodiment of the present utility model is described, should be appreciated that preferred embodiment described herein is only for description and interpretation the utility model, and be not used in restriction the utility model.
As shown in Figure 1, 2, a kind of vertical injection molding machine, comprises pallet 1, lower fixing base 2, bracing frame 3, upper locked mode cylinder body 4, pull bar 5, piston rod 6, movable cope match-plate pattern 7 and auxiliary cylinder 8; Lower fixing base 2 is placed in pallet 1 upper surface, lower fixing base 2 upper surfaces two bracing frames 3 staggered relatively, locked mode cylinder body 4 is set up in bracing frame 3 upper surfaces, and pull bar 5 is successively through upper locked mode cylinder body 5, bracing frame 3, lower fixing base 2 and pallet 1, and two ends are fixed with nut; Upper locked mode cylinder body 4 comprises four oil cylinders 9, and a guide pin bushing is contained in each oil cylinder 9 lower surface, inserts a piston rod 6 in each guide pin bushing, and the lower end of every two piston rods 6 connects the upper surface of a movable cope match-plate pattern 7; The lateral surface of each oil cylinder 9 of upper locked mode cylinder body 4 is provided with an auxiliary cylinder 8, and auxiliary cylinder 8 is connected with the lateral surface of movable cope match-plate pattern 7 by latch; Movable cope match-plate pattern 7 lateral surface corners are provided with sliding sleeve 10, and bracing frame 3 medial surfaces are provided with slide rail 11, and sliding sleeve 10 is slidably connected with slide rail 11.
The quantity of pull bar, sliding sleeve and slide rail is four.
This vertical injection molding machine is arranged on machine top by driving mechanism, thereby has reduced operating table surface, convenient operation; Complete machine structure combination is installed as a chair mechanisms, and rigidity has obtained large increase; Utilize the relative sliding between sliding sleeve and slide rail, make movable cope match-plate pattern keeping parallelism state when activity, generation is rocked in restriction, guarantees the precision of running.
